  8. Public Records ActHot Topics • SHB 1899:Effective July 22, 2011, the per day penalty is $0 up to a maximum of $100 (subject to the court’s discretion) • Zink v. Mesa (June 7, 2011) • Remand for new determination of penalties • Retroactive application of SHB 1899? • No obligation to produce documents that don’t exist • See also, BIAW v. McCarthy (2009) • Claims under PRA and retention provisions www.mrsc.org (206) 625-1300

  9. Public Records ActHot Topics Public Hospital District Considerations: Sunshine Committee – discussing exemption re: closed claims Key more general issue: PRA and records retention issues related to use of non-district computers, smart phones, and other devices www.mrsc.org (206) 625-1300

PRA & Records RetentionPractical Tips • Your district needs to have a knowledgeable and highly competent Public Records Officer • Enact, implement, and enforce sound PRA and records retention policies • Electronic records can be challenging • MRSC, AWPHD, and WAPRO are good resources www.mrsc.org (206) 625-1300

  11. OPMAHot Topics Can a quorum of commissioners participate in a training session together and not violate the OPMA? Serial meetings Confidentiality issues regarding executive sessions www.mrsc.org (206) 625-1300

  12. ElectionsHot Topics Most local governments face campaign contribution limits under RCW 42.17.640 The PDC has indicated that the limits in RCW 42.17.640 do not apply to candidates for public hospital district commissioner www.mrsc.org (206) 625-1300

EthicsHot Topics • Chapter 42.23 RCW • Contract Interests • RCW 42.23.030: No municipal officer may have a contract interest, directly or indirectly, in any contract which may be made by, through, or under the supervision of such officer, in whole or in part … • Special Privileges www.mrsc.org (206) 625-1300
